Co-expression of PrPc and p-Akt in gastric cancer and its clinical significance

  • Objective To study the expression of PrPc and p-Akt in gastric cancer tissue and its clinical significance. Methods Expressions of PrPc and p-Akt in gastric cancer tissue and its adjacent tissue were detected by immunohistochemistry. Results The positive expression rate of PrPc and p-Akt was 82.4%(66/85) and 88.2%(75/85),respectively,in 85 gastric cancer patients,which was significantly higher than that in its adjacent tissue(r=0.514,P<0.05).The expression levels of PrPc and p-Akt were significantly correlated with the down-regulated differentiation of gastric cancer cells and up-regulated expression of PrPc and p-Akt in gastric cancer tissue(P<0.05). Conclusion PrPc and p-Akt are synergistically expressed in gastric cancer tissue,and p-Akt may play a role in PrPc-induced malignant phenotype of gastric cancer.
